Trevor Cox - Principal Engineer
|
Trevor is a software developer and entrepreneur who has worked on a wide variety of software products in use all over the world. His various software contributions help run cellular telephones and parking lot paystations, allow people to make wireless phone calls over the Internet from a Pocket PC, collect University applications online, and administer Voice over IP enterprise communication systems. They have helped train Boeing 737 pilots, monitor a U.K. transportation system, and improve safety for a client in Denmark.
Trevor has been programming for over 20 years, and has a B.A.Sc. degree in Computer Engineering (electrical and software engineering) from the University of British Columbia. He was the co-founder of Geodyssey Electronic Development Inc. (1989), Gigazad Networks Inc. (2005) and since 1997 has provided software development services at Skaha Software. |
